2015-10-15 21 views
10

Tôi hiện đang làm việc trên hệ thống Kiosk dựa trên Raspberry Pi 2 chạy Raspbian chạy ứng dụng Java. Mọi thứ hoạt động hoàn hảo tốt, ngoại trừ một sự biến dạng trên màn hình xuất hiện khi các đối tượng đang chuyển động. Thông thường, đây không phải là vấn đề, nhưng tôi có một danh sách trên ứng dụng Java sẽ được người dùng sử dụng rộng rãi. Biến dạng hiển thị trong khi cuộn trên danh sách này.Raspberry Pi 2 - Biến dạng khi di chuyển đối tượng ở chế độ Chân dung

Các liên kết dưới đây cho thấy điều này trong hành động:

A GIF showing the distortion

Những gì tôi biết cho đến nay:

  • này chỉ xảy ra trong khi màn hình được xoay. Tôi đã xoay màn hình bằng 270 * bằng cách thiết lập “display_rotate=3” trong /boot/config.txt
  • Nó không phải là phụ thuộc vào độ phân giải màn hình hoặc “hdmi_group"
  • này không chỉ xảy ra trên GUI, sự biến dạng cũng là có thể nhìn thấy trong thời gian khởi động
  • Overlocking không ảnh hưởng đến sự biến dạng
  • Nó luôn luôn appearson phía bên phải phía dưới màn hình
  • vấn đề này cũng đã có mặt trong Ubuntu Mate
+4

Xuất hiện thành * "xé màn hình" *. Bạn có biết cách bật 'VSYNC' (chờ đợi cho vsync) trong ngăn xếp phần mềm đang được sử dụng không? Kiểm tra thay thế các tùy chọn cấu hình để tăng gấp đôi/gấp ba bộ đệm khung hiển thị framebuffer? – TheCodeArtist

+0

Bạn đã thử cập nhật chương trình cơ sở chưa? Xem http://raspberrypi.stackexchange.com/questions/37645/when-using-display-rotate-1-the-screen-tears –

+0

Liệu nó có xảy ra với các góc quay khác, như 90 độ không? – pietv8x

Trả lời

0

Tôi không phải là một chuyên gia trong Linux hoặc bất cứ điều gì tương tự nhưng nghe tôi,

Bạn nói rằng bạn xoay màn hình của mình trong tệp cấu hình. Bạn có thể đặt nó trở lại mặc định không? Tại sao bạn cần nó để được luân chuyển? Bởi vì vòng xoay này có thể làm cho nó tắt các phần của màn hình. Trước tiên tôi sẽ cho vấn đề của bạn xem xét thử nghiệm với biến đó và xem nó thay đổi như thế nào. :)

Các vấn đề liên quan